Harry sat in the Common Room with his girlfriend, Hermione, and his best friend, Ron. They were looking at pictures from the past. Every occasion was in there. Summer breaks, Christmases, Easters, birthdays, dances, and many more.
Hermione laid her head on Harry's shoulder as he came upon pictures of his parents. First of their wedding. He looked into his mother's smiling face. She grinned at him so brightly, it was almost magical. His father was grinning and laughing, just like his godfather, Sirius, who stood in the back round.
Next, came a picture of his father and mother ballroom dancing. His mother was in a beautiful pale pink gown. Her red hair was in an elegant bun. His father was in a black tux. His wild black hair stuck out at odd ends, like Harry's.
Then came a picture that made Harry's heart drop. His father was dancing with him. He spun him round as he held baby Harry tightly in his arms. James's eyes were on Harry the whole time. He smiled at him as baby Harry laughed up a storm.
"Harry? Are you okay?" Hermione asked him. But Harry didn't answer, for he was locked up in the picture of him and his father.

A single, perfect shaped tear rolled down Harry's round cheek and landed on the picture of him and his father. Hermione took hold of his hand.
"I just wish I could see him, dance with him again." Harry said as another tear followed the already dropped one.
"Your father, at this every moment and every moment, is wishing the exact same thing." Ron said next to Harry.
